Yeti's Heavy Armor Skill Tree

Description
***No longer being updated or supported***
- I no longer have the free time to support these mods, but I will check back every once in a while if I find some time.

Removes the requirements of all perks requiring a head piece for boosts/ augments.
Changes cushioned perk for a new perk, Insulated

Insulated
Increases in-combat health recovery by 30% when in heavy armor: chest, feet, hands
